{ stdenv, fetchurl, buildPackages, perl
, buildPlatform, hostPlatform
, withCryptodev ? false, cryptodevHeaders
, enableSSL2 ? false
, static ? false
}:
with stdenv.lib;
let
common = args@{ version, sha256, patches ? [] }: stdenv.mkDerivation rec {
name = "openssl-${version}";
src = fetchurl {
url = "https://www.openssl.org/source/${name}.tar.gz";
inherit sha256;
};
patches =
(args.patches or [])
++ [ ./nix-ssl-cert-file.patch ]
++ optional (versionOlder version "1.1.0")
(if hostPlatform.isDarwin then ./use-etc-ssl-certs-darwin.patch else ./use-etc-ssl-certs.patch)
++ optional (versionOlder version "1.0.2" && hostPlatform.isDarwin)
./darwin-arch.patch;
postPatch = if (versionAtLeast version "1.1.0" && stdenv.hostPlatform.isMusl) then ''
substituteInPlace crypto/async/arch/async_posix.h \
--replace '!defined(__ANDROID__) && !defined(__OpenBSD__)' \
'!defined(__ANDROID__) && !defined(__OpenBSD__) && 0'
'' else null;
outputs = [ "bin" "dev" "out" "man" ];
setOutputFlags = false;
separateDebugInfo = hostPlatform.isLinux;
nativeBuildInputs = [ perl ];
buildInputs = stdenv.lib.optional withCryptodev cryptodevHeaders;
# TODO(@Ericson2314): Improve with mass rebuild
configureScript = {
"x86_64-darwin" = "./Configure darwin64-x86_64-cc";
"x86_64-solaris" = "./Configure solaris64-x86_64-gcc";
}.${hostPlatform.system} or (
if hostPlatform == buildPlatform
then "./config"
else if hostPlatform.isMinGW
then "./Configure mingw${optionalString
(hostPlatform.parsed.cpu.bits != 32)
(toString hostPlatform.parsed.cpu.bits)}"
else if hostPlatform.isLinux
then "./Configure linux-generic${toString hostPlatform.parsed.cpu.bits}"
else if hostPlatform.isiOS
then "./Configure ios${toString hostPlatform.parsed.cpu.bits}-cross"
else
throw "Not sure what configuration to use for ${hostPlatform.config}"
);
# TODO(@Ericson2314): Make unconditional on mass rebuild
${if buildPlatform != hostPlatform then "configurePlatforms" else null} = [];
preConfigure = ''
patchShebangs Configure
'';
configureFlags = [
"shared" # "shared" builds both shared and static libraries
"--libdir=lib"
"--openssldir=etc/ssl"
] ++ stdenv.lib.optionals withCryptodev [
"-DHAVE_CRYPTODEV"
"-DUSE_CRYPTODEV_DIGESTS"
] ++ stdenv.lib.optional enableSSL2 "enable-ssl2"
++ stdenv.lib.optional (versionAtLeast version "1.1.0" && hostPlatform.isAarch64) "no-afalgeng";
makeFlags = [ "MANDIR=$(man)/share/man" ];
enableParallelBuilding = true;
postInstall =
stdenv.lib.optionalString (!static) ''
# If we're building dynamic libraries, then don't install static
# libraries.
if [ -n "$(echo $out/lib/*.so $out/lib/*.dylib $out/lib/*.dll)" ]; then
rm "$out/lib/"*.a
fi
'' +
''
mkdir -p $bin
mv $out/bin $bin/
mkdir $dev
mv $out/include $dev/
# remove dependency on Perl at runtime
rm -r $out/etc/ssl/misc
rmdir $out/etc/ssl/{certs,private}
'';
postFixup = ''
# Check to make sure the main output doesn't depend on perl
if grep -r '${buildPackages.perl}' $out; then
echo "Found an erroneous dependency on perl ^^^" >&2
exit 1
fi
'';
meta = {
homepage = https://www.openssl.org/;
description = "A cryptographic library that implements the SSL and TLS protocols";
platforms = stdenv.lib.platforms.all;
maintainers = [ stdenv.lib.maintainers.peti ];
priority = 10; # resolves collision with ‘man-pages’
};
};
in {
openssl_1_0_2 = common {
version = "1.0.2o";
sha256 = "0kcy13l701054nhpbd901mz32v1kn4g311z0nifd83xs2jbmqgzc";
};
openssl_1_1_0 = common {
version = "1.1.0h";
sha256 = "05x509lccqjscgyi935z809pwfm708islypwhmjnb6cyvrn64daq";
patches = [
./revert-relaxed-quoting.patch
];
};
}
